Late last year some of South Africa’s most prolific bands and artists, including the likes of JR, Die Heuwels Fantasties, Locnville, Van Coke Kartel, aKING and Thieve merged their talents and genres to collaborate on a unique version of Corey Hart’s hit Sunglasses at Night. Their cover was such a spectacular nod to the 80′s hit that it had to be great.
Ray-Ban South Africa initiated the project as part of their ongoing love affair with local music and has made the song available for song free. Fantastic I know!
Today the music video was released and it was pure 80′s goodness. Think crazy arcade games. Cheesy clothes. Tracksuits. An Uno Turbo street race between Laudo Liebenberg and Francois van Coke. Oh and lots and lots of amazing Ray-Ban sunglasses of course.
